I'm a newer player and have recently started tanking more, and like it a lot. However, when I do content and someone else claims the main tank role, I let it slide. I never wanna be that "fighting other tanks for aggro" guy. So I just try to maximize my DPS.
Obviously, in fights with adds, I grab them ASAP. That's brainless. But what of fights with no adds?
I play PLD and DRK. On my DRK, I got synced to 70 during a trial and didn't really know what to do outisde of DPSing as hard as I could, so I'd occasionally throw TBN on the MT if I saw that his mitigation CDs were down. My logic was that I was helping lower the damage taken by the raid, which is my job anyway, right? Plus if TBN is fully used, I get a free Edge of Darkness anyway so it's DPS neutral. I also throw out Reprisal when I can. Am I supposed to be doing that?
On my PLD, I haven't used him too much in trials or raids, b ut I was considering using Cover on the MT if I saw that his HP was low, but then I was worried that it would mess with the healers by changing who was taking damage without really announcing it.
So basically, what are my responsibilities as OT in single-target fights? Throw out my own mitigators to help out the MT, or just focus 100% on DPS?
